A heatpump is an all-in-one cooling and heating system that provides both heating and cooling. The system works by taking in and launching warmth from the air or ground with a compressor making use of turning around valves.

While the in advance expense might be more than various other heating systems, the lasting cost savings of a heat pump make it well worth the financial investment.



Myth 1: Heat pumps do not work well in chilly climates.
Heatpump are an essential part of the electrification of home heating, and they are getting appeal in Europe and The United States And copyright. Yet some individuals fear about using them in their homes due to myths and mistaken beliefs.

A basic heat pump is a device that absorbs one unit of energy (in the form of electrical power) and uses it to generate 3 or 4 systems of home heating. This is an extremely high performance proportion, and even at freezing temperatures heat pumps can perform well.

Unlike nonrenewable fuel source furnaces that utilize gas to produce warm, a heatpump essences thermal power from the air or ground. compact wall mounted air conditioner implies that heatpump are more economical to run in the majority of climates compared to conventional fossil-fuel systems, except throughout the very chilliest hours of the year when they should work harder. However, this can be offset by installing a properly-sized backup furnace to connect those very chilly periods.

Myth 4: Heatpump don't conserve money.
It's wonderful that heatpump are obtaining the spotlight for their eco-friendly features but that additionally suggests that there is a great deal of false information out there regarding what they can actually do. One of the most usual false impressions is that heat pumps don't save money-- this is entirely not true.

Of course, in order to achieve this degree of performance you require to have a well-insulated home with underfloor home heating and standard-size radiators that will make the most of the heat offered by the pump. But, even in poorly-insulated houses, heatpump are still an extra cost-efficient choice than standard fossil fuel systems. And, oftentimes, the cost savings from switching to a heat pump can be comprised within just a few years.
